NettetARM Instruction Format ¾Each instruction is encoded into a 32-bit word ¾Access to memory is provided only by Load and Store instructions ¾The basic encoding format for the instructions, such as Load, Store, Move, Arithmetic, and Logic instructions, is shown below ¾An instruction specifies a conditional execution code NettetIt's an instruction to set the doors to automatic mode so that emergency evacuation slides will deploy when the door is opened. The cross-check means that after arming their assigned door, the ...
What is MOVS in assembly language? – KnowledgeBurrow.com
Nettet16-bit instructions. The following forms of this instruction are available in Thumb code, and are 16-bit instructions: MOVS , # Rd imm. Rd must be a Lo register. imm range 0-255. This form can only be used outside an IT block. MOV{} , # cond Rd imm. Rd must be a Lo register. imm range 0-255. This form can only be used inside an IT block. MOVS ... NettetThe MVN instruction takes the value of Operand2, performs a bitwise logical NOT operation on the value, and places the result into Rd. Note The MOVW instruction … cold turkey benzo
02: ARM Cortex-M Move Instructions - YouTube
Nettet6. mar. 2024 · This is apparently a separate instruction with a separate opcode even in Thumb mode. .syntax unified .thumb_func adds r1, r2, #0 movs r1, r2 arm-none-eabi … Nettet6. apr. 2024 · Bootloader for ARM Cortex-M4F (SOLVED) I'm trying to add a bootloader to an ATMEL ATSAME54N19A microcontroller (Cortex-M4F with 512 KB of flash). I'm using MPLAB IPE (Microchip's programming environment) and xc32 (Microchip's compiler which AFAIK is a gcc port). I've created two separate projects, one for the bootloader with … Nettet27. apr. 2024 · 1 mov.w is just a mov instruction. The disassembler appends a .w suffix to indicate that a 32 bit encoding of the instruction was used. – fuz Apr 27, 2024 at 21:46 … dr michael haghighi